Re:How should I play against deep stacked players on a NL HE cash game?
also all that matters is effective stacks. If u open a 30 bb stack and given ur range is reasonably tight they are makign a pretty huge mistake vs ur range calling with marginal and specualtive hands. why does it matter if he has 1k if effective stacks are only 400 or whatever. Seems like a leak in ur thought process

Re:JJ on Low Stakes Tournament (BIG problem)
ImonTilt i understand your point and I think it reduces variance greatly. But at smaller stakes the biggest leak of all the opponents is they calling too often with low pot equity and we can force them into mistakes by betting and raising.
